The most recent work in this category of the cinema art is Dead Whisper (2024), a story of loss, temptation and vengeance, which will do anything to see the deceased once again. This film is directed by Conor Soucy and it is a story of Elliot Campbell, a lawyer from Cape Cod who has to face a chance of getting to an island for the purpose of meeting his dead daughter but at the same time risking his soul. This mysterious place has a special significance for Elliot because it is his only opportunity to meet his daughter, but with a cost that is almost too, his soul.
The film is located on an strange island off the coast of Cape Cod and this makes the environment to be very much mysterious and lonely; this contributes to the tension as Elliot moves on to explore the unknown field. You get the vibe of the movie as some of the scenes are very gothic like, such as the choice of the gloomy scenery and the themes related to the sea and fog, similar to the New England, Ireland, and UK films, add atmosphere which is both oppressive and enchanting. Such combination of the tension arising from the gloomy scenery and the fear of the supernatural darkness is characteristic of the North Atlantic sub genre of horror, to which the Dead Whisper movie probably belongs.

They say that the main strength of an actor is the ability to depict a troubled soul, and here, he succeeds splendidly in showing the inner conflict between grief and temptation.Among the actors who are featured in the movie, Rob Evan, a Broadway actor is among the most important cast. Evan is popular for Les Miserables and Jekyll & Hyde although he was also cast in other productions such as Little Shop of Horrors, Tarzan among others.
Another well experienced actor, Tana Sirois has also involved in the film with her experience of the improvisation since most of her work is from theater itself. Her previous works include concept and performance creation in New York City, London, and Istanbul, and she is also a co founder of a non profit cultural organization in New York.
